> I'd much rather just use some stale "struct task_struct" data.

The problem isn't the risk of using stale data: it is the risk of using
complete garbage if the task_struct page gets reused. The procfs code
does check that tsk->mm is non-zero before following the pointers, but
if there is a non-zero address there then it _will_ be dereferenced
regardless.

> What we _might_ do in /proc, is to just increment the usage count for the
> (double) page that contains the task structure,

That would certainly take care of it.
